Jim Croce - Classic Hits
Jim Croce has always had a knack for coming up with up-beat and catchy songs that have been instant hits on the radio. Although his life was tragically cut short at the age of 30, his songs will be loved and treasured for years to come. This fantastic songbook, "Jim Croce Classic Hits" contains 19 of his best and most popular songs which are presented to you in "Strum It" guitar format. "The Bass Player Book" is the essential all-in-one handbook for both acoustic and electric bass players, offering invaluable advice and instruction on technique, gear, and, most importantly, inspiration. Packed with dozens of photos, musician profiles, and in-depth musical examples, this book is a must for the beginner as well as the battle-hardened veteran. "The Bass Player Book" has three main parts: Playing the Bass, Equipment, and Innovators. Parts one and two each start with beginner information and progress toward material for the more advanced bassist. Part one, "Playing the Bass" includes information on theory, groove and sense of time, gigging, slapping and harmonics, and rock, jazz, blues, country, and Latin styles. Part two takes you from buying an instrument to hooking up a full amp system, choosing effects, and recording. Plus there's a photo essay on the most notable electric basses ever designed. Part three contains stories on seven bassists who forever changed the way the instrument was played: James Jamerson, Paul McCartney, Larry Graham, Stanley Clarke, Jaco Pastorius, Flea, and Les Claypool. You'll find these artists' words inspiring no matter where you are in the learning process. "The Bass Player Book" also contains a discography of the 30 best bass albums you must own.
